I've just replaced my front turn signals from 21watt bulb fittings to LED clusters, unfortunalty these don't draw enough power from the circuit to trigger the flash correctly, i'm getting a very slow flash rate and no turn indication in the vehicle. When I reattach the bulbs it works fine so I know I havent fryed anything. I need to find a good resistor setup to simulate  the load the original bulbs would have had on the circuit, then wire the LEDs in paralel.

Could anyone with more understanding of Ohms law and didn't flunk math help me please.
